freezer in Swedish is frys, frysskåp, frysfack — freezer means an appliance, or a compartment within a refrigerator, used to store food at below-freezing temperatures.

freezer in Swedish

frys
noun
An appliance or room used to store food or other perishable items at temperatures below 0° Celsius (32° Fahrenheit).
frysskåp
noun
An appliance or room used to store food or other perishable items at temperatures below 0° Celsius (32° Fahrenheit).
frysfack
noun
The section of a refrigerator used to store food or other perishable items at a temperature below 0° Celsius (32° Fahrenheit).
